When Pune dance events hit a major roadblock on Monday, September 7, 2026, after local police filed a case against performer Radha Patil-Mumbaikar and local organizers for staging an unauthorized program without prior clearance, the ripple effects were felt far beyond Maharashtra. The Bibwewadi police registered the case following a Dahi Handi celebration at Bhairavnath Society in Katraj, where organizers allegedly proceeded despite a direct permit denial. Simultaneously, authorities in Kesnand refused permission for a planned Lavani performance by dancer Aishwarya Jadhav Laturkar, citing public safety and missing certifications.

Navigating the Maze of Event Permissions

Organizing a cultural event or public stage performance involves far more than booking artists and setting up a sound system. Police departments across urban centers demand exhaustive documentation, safety certifications, and advance notice to manage crowds effectively. When event planners bypass these mandatory steps, enforcement actions can be swift and severe, leaving society heads and coordinators facing unexpected legal notices.
